Output 58f3132183b45169c2d1ece12357c4363788c730b3b9b56408dd36ade8ed5c96:0

value
439124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fb82c018c6e4cce9df1a78360f022f98422d80b OP_EQUAL
address
3DLLNPoui24dqZ6AxTYj6mrymPSNRxPcxQ
transaction
58f3132183b45169c2d1ece12357c4363788c730b3b9b56408dd36ade8ed5c96
confirmations
195572
spent
true